Understanding the intricate relationship between sexual arousal and testosterone levels is vital for grasping the broader concepts of health, libido, and intimacy in men’s health. Testosterone, the primary male sex hormone, plays a crucial role in various physiological functions, including sexual health, muscle mass, and mood regulation. This article aims to delve into how sexual arousal may influence testosterone levels, highlighting its implications for overall health and well-being.

Some medications can affect testosterone levels. Discuss any concerns with your doctor, especially if you notice changes in libido or sexual function.
Evaluate your lifestyle choices. Factors such as poor diet, lack of exercise, and high stress can contribute to low testosterone levels.
Consider seeking support from a therapist or counselor if psychological factors are affecting your sexual health and intimacy. Open communication with your partner can also help alleviate concerns.
